β¦ Synopsis
This paper describes the synthesis of phosphorylated peptides of the general structure Ac-Tyr(PO3HR)-Glu-Xaa-NH 2, where Xaa represents a hydrophobic 7-amino acid of D-configuration. These peptides displayed activities in the micromolar range in inhibiting src-SH2 domain/epidermal growth factor receptor interactions.
